Love Letters

I walk in an endless summer
A summer that reminds me of her
I walk slow cause I'm not a runner
A sunset to take in but I only feel number
It's getting boring but I should know better
Not to invite her in, she's always bitter -
That I ,
Neglected the tears
Made fun of my fears
Overwhelmed my psyche with cheers
Drowned my heart in beer
With a joint over my ear
Perhaps she was always my seer
I see her less and less these days
Sometimes I even forget about that phase
Snuggled in bed with my favorite sweaters
Only to find one of her sweet sweet love letters
